Fig. 1: Overall structure of the TMR-DN-bound RhoBAST aptamer.

From: Structural mechanisms for binding and activation of a contact-quenched fluorophore by RhoBAST

Fig. 1

a Chemical structures of the conditional fluorophores of TMR-DN and SpyRho. b The previously predicted secondary structure of RhoBAST WT. c An updated secondary structure of RhoBAST (L2-U1 construct) from the crystal structure in this work. d A schematic representation of the secondary structure of RhoBAST highlighting long-range interactions and non-canonical base pairs. Thin lines with arrowheads and Leontis–Westhof symbols denote connectivity and base pairs, respectively. e Cartoon representation of the three-dimensional structure of the RhoBAST aptamer in complex with TMR-DN (red stick representation) and U1A protein (gray surface representation) in three orthogonal views. Two Mg2+ ions are shown as magenta.
